Berlin usually lacks the masses of business travellers which other German cities in the Western part of the country have. That's why it's sometimes harder to get a cheap room in Berlin in the summer months or over long weekends than it is the case for cities like Frankfurt, Dusseldorf and even Hamburg (where it's usually vice versa).
